Within the dilapidated village, a carriage slowly stopped, attracting the attention of all the residents.
Under the gazes of all the residents, a figure walked out of the carriage.
It was a handsome and graceful young man. His figure was tall and straight, and his deep eyes were like a pair of pure black gems, exuding an indescribable charm.
He slowly walked down from the carriage and stood under the radiance of the sun. His fair skin was exposed from his neck and arms, and his straight long hair was meticulously draped over his shoulders, swaying slowly with the breeze.
Compared to the past, the person at this moment had not changed. It was just that the noble, calm, and amiable temperament, as well as his eye-catching elegance were breathtaking. Just by looking at him, one could not help but be attracted.
Looking at this young man, the surrounding scavengers rubbed their eyes in disbelief, almost not daring to believe that this person in front of them had crawled out from the battlefield.
When he crawled out from the battlefield, Adil's body was still on the verge of death. His entire body was covered in wounds and blood, so naturally, his original appearance could not be seen.
At that time, even though these scavengers had dragged him out from the battlefield, seeing the injuries on his body, almost all of them thought that he would not live for long, so naturally, no one would waste the effort to take care of a 'dead' person.
However, now that Adil had recovered his consciousness and escaped from the state of near-death, it made them feel disbelief and extremely strong shock.
Looking around in Silence, Adil finally looked in a certain direction.
There, Wendy was standing there in a daze, looking at Adil's current appearance. She was also in a daze, feeling a strong sense of unfamiliarity.
"Come on up."
Looking at the girl standing in the distance in a daze, Adil did not mind at all. A smile appeared on his face, and he waved at her, indicating for her to directly come up to the carriage.
Without too many twists and turns, Adil very smoothly picked up the girl, and there were no accidents on the way.
However, after picking up the girl, Adil distributed some of the things he had bought in the future and gave them all to the villagers. He even gave some money to the people who had carried him out of the battlefield as a reward for their actions.
Taking into account some accidents, the value of the coins that Adil gave was not too much, but for scavengers, it was enough. It was not enough to make people think of murdering them for money, and it could also make their lives slightly better.
If these people were smart enough, they could directly use this money to enter the city, exchange for an official identity and some farming land, so that they would not continue to live such a poor life outside.
Under the driver's control, the carriage slowly but firmly moved forward.
At the last moment before leaving the village, Adil turned to look in the direction of the village. In the middle of the village, the corpse of the zombie was lying there, its expression still as ferocious and terrifying as ever.
Adil shook his head gently, and looked at Wendy, who had already fallen asleep. He did not think about the village anymore, and just thought about the next journey in Silence.
The war between the Kingdom of Senai and the Kingdom of Tamlu had been going on for a long time.
According to the memories of his previous body, the southern part of the Kingdom of Tamlu had already fallen, and it was only a matter of time before it was completely conquered by the Kingdom of Senai.
There were many problems in the Kingdom of Tamlu itself. Not only were there many opposing nobles and territories in the country, but there were also many problems with the royal family itself. Due to the issue of the heir, there had been several large-scale civil strife.
Under such circumstances, facing the sudden attack of several kingdoms led by the Kingdom of Senai, it was likely that the Kingdom of Tamlu would not be able to recover this area in a short period of time.
The territory of the family that Adil's current body belonged to was in this area.
Facing the attack of the Kingdom of Senai, the Bakuru Family could not resist at all. There were only two outcomes left.
They could either directly surrender, or move north with the army of the Kingdom of Tamlu.
Neither of these two outcomes had a good ending.
If they stayed in their original territory and accepted the rule of the Kingdom of Senai, as the defeated party, they would definitely be treated differently. Even if the Bakuru Family did not do anything to them because of their deep roots, they would definitely be suppressed in various ways.
Moreover, if they made this choice, they might face even more difficult difficulties in the future.
Even though they had lost this war, the true power of the Kingdom of Tamlu was actually above that of the Kingdom of Senai.
If not for the internal strife in the Kingdom of Tamlu, where the nobles with real power were fighting each other, and the sudden attack by the Kingdom of Senai and several other kingdoms, they most likely would not have lost this war.
However, after the outcome of the succession battle of the Kingdom of Tamlu was announced, the next king would officially appear, and the kingdom would definitely move south again to take back all the territory that the Kingdom of Senai had swallowed.
If that happened, and the Kingdom of Tamlu succeeded in expelling the Kingdom of Senai, what would happen to the Bakuru Family that had surrendered to the Kingdom of Senai?
However, if they changed their mindset and gave up their territory and moved north with the army, that would not be a good idea either.
It was unknown how long the internal strife in the Kingdom of Tamlu would last. If it lasted for too long, after losing their territory, the Bakuru Family's influence would quickly decline, and some of the benefits that they had might even be divided up by the other nobles who were jealous of them.
This was destined to be a very difficult choice. If they made the wrong choice, it would immediately lead to the decline of the entire family, and it would not be impossible for them to fall from the ranks of nobles.
However, for Adil, it was not important what they would choose for the time being.
His next goal was to go all the way north and leave this area.
It had been a few days since that night's battle.
In these few days, with the power bestowed by his main body, Adil had already activated the seed of life, and became a true knight. In other words, he was an Official Knight of this world.
And this was far from the end.
Even though the power that Adil had split off was insignificant compared to his main body, it was unimaginably terrifying for those at a lower level.
According to Adil's estimation, if he used up all the power he had split off, he would at least be able to regain the strength of a Heavenly Knight, which was equivalent to a Silver Knight in this world.
At this level, the danger of this world would be greatly reduced. Some dangers that were not a problem for ordinary people would no longer be a problem. Even if they were surrounded by an army, they would not feel pressured at all, as they could single-handedly defeat the enemy.
Only at this level could Adil relax a little, and he would begin to try to explore this world, delving into its secrets, and obtain more information.
"Soon, soon …"
Sitting in the carriage in Silence, feeling the aura pulsating all over his body, Adil said softly, "At most three months, I will be able to completely digest this bit of power."
A series of sounds rang out, accompanied by the creaking of the carriage wheels, as the carriage slowly advanced into the distance, gradually driving into a city in the distance.
